LOS ANGELES, Nov. 3 (UPI) -- CBS said Tuesday it has ordered five additional episodes of its freshman U.S. comedy series "Accidentally on Purpose."

The season will now include 18 episodes, the network said in a news release.

"Accidentally on Purpose" stars Jenna Elfman, Ashley Jensen, Jon Foster, Grant Show, Lennon Parham and Nicolas Wright. The ensemble comedy focuses on a successful, single journalist who accidentally gets pregnant by a much younger man.
